I did this to get the FD on my Schwinn SS. As I remember, I used a metal file that was rounded to just under the profile needed for the FD. It took quite a while, and was a bit tense knowing the FD was likely going to be unusable if I managed to mess it up. Filing at the ends of the clamps is where most of the material was removed to allow it to go over the wider tubing. In the middle I did remove some, but the clamp itself can bend a bit to get the new radius. Wound up using the same bolt on the clamp as on the other bike. Left a bit more of a gap when clamped than on the old frame, but works just the same.
